Arlington was not able to break out of their rough patch on Saturday as the team picked up their sixth straight loss dating back to last season. They came up short against the Miller City Wildcats, falling 12-0. The Red Devils were not able to make up for their defeat to the Wildcats from their previous meeting back in April of 2025.
Arlington's loss dropped their record down to 0-4. As for Miller City, their win bumped their record up to 4-2.
The teams didn't have to wait long for a rematch: the Wildcats beat Arlington by a score of 11-0 later that day.
